I think checklists are nice both as a submitter and as a reviewer and I think they are friendlier to new contributors. It's easier to check a button than understanding what do I have to put on a free-form text. I agree with @zanmato1984 comments above that some of the checks on these checklist are similarly covered today either by our PR description or the linked issue. For example the **Are these changes tested?** section on our current PR description cover a similar case than the testing part presented on the checklist.
